#3181b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3181bc is composed of 19.2% red, 50.6%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.9% cyan, 31.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 205.5 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 46.5%. #3181bc color hex could be obtained by blending #62ffff with #000379.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

● #3181bc color description : Moderate blue.
#3181bc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3181bc has RGB values of R:49, G:129,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 3244476.
